If a solid sphere of mass 1 kg and radius 0.1 m rolls without slipping at a uniform velocity of 1 m/s along a straight line on a horizontal floor, the kinetic energy is
Options
(a) (7/5) J
(b) (2/5) J
(c) (7/10) J
(d) 1 J
Correct Answer:
(7/10) J
